    It WORKED perfectly!! 1LE mount installed WITHOUT a spacer!

    The problem is that the V6 5-speed has a 1/2" drop in the mount cross-member. I replaced the V6 cross-member with a LT1 auto cross-member which is straight - no 1/2" drop.


    V6 Manual Cross-member (rear)
    V8 Auto Cross-member (front)





    1LE Installed




    NOTE: The 93-97 and 98+ cross-members are NOT interchangable. The body holes are different.
